What's Happening?
An opinion piece discusses the benefits of academics sharing their health challenges with colleagues. The author recounts personal experiences with cancer and emphasizes the support received from colleagues,
which helped navigate the difficulties of treatment and academic responsibilities. The article advocates for openness about health issues to foster a supportive environment and reduce the burden on individuals facing serious health challenges.
Why It's Important?
Sharing health challenges in academic settings can lead to increased support and understanding, reducing isolation and stress for those affected. This approach can improve workplace culture, encouraging empathy and collaboration among colleagues. It also highlights the need for institutions to provide flexible arrangements and resources for employees dealing with health issues, promoting a healthier and more inclusive work environment.
